A woman from the Chicago area has been charged with reckless homicide and driving under the influence following a crash in Rockford that led to the death of a 25-year-old woman early Sunday morning. Rockford Police reported that a car carrying three people crashed into a wall at the roundabout on Kishwaukee Street and Airport Drive around 2:42 a.m. Unfortunately, the victim, who was sitting in the back seat, passed away later at a local hospital. Alazia Hatchett, 30, from Orland Hills, is facing criminal charges including aggravated DUI causing death and reckless homicide in connection to the incident.
